Step 2: Water Extraction

Our crew uses heavy-duty pumps and vacuums to extract water from your property, including walls, floors, and ceilings. We’ll also remove any standing water and saturated materials to prevent further damage. Our equipment is designed to handle large volumes of water! We’ll work efficiently to reduce downtime.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our team will use specialized equipment to dry your property, including air movers and dehumidifiers. This ensures your home is thoroughly dry and free of moisture, preventing further damage and promoting a healthy environment. Our equipment is designed to handle large areas! Residential Water Removal Cost In Amityville, NY

The cost of Residential Water Removal services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Amityville, NY.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ation. Get a free estimate today! We’ll work with your insurance to reduce costs! Get your home dry and safe within 60 minutes!

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The amount of water extracted and the size of the affected area.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ed.
Disinfection and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the type of cleaning products used.
Restoration and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repairs.
